Sandstone, a sedimentary rock, owes its existence to the gradual accumulation and solidification of tiny fragments of weathered rock. Over vast stretches of time, these grains are transported by agents throughout extensive terrains. As these transporting forces weaken, the sand particles settle in layers, slowly forming the basis for future sedimentary layers.

The makeup of sandstone can vary widely depending on its geographic location. Quartz-rich varieties are frequently observed in areas where hard rock formations have been weathered over time.

The history of sandstone goes far into billions of years, offering a wealth of information into past climatic shifts. Through its seams, we can understand ancient oceans, and the dynamic changes that have modified our planet over millennia.

Geological Processes Shaping Sandstone Formations

Sandstone formations result from a captivating interplay of geological processes spanning millions of years. Sedimentation is the initial step, where grains of sand are moved by forces such as wind, water, or ice and deposited in a setting. Over time, these strata of material become compressed under the pressure of overlying layers. Lamination then takes place, where substances dissolved in groundwater precipitate between the grains, bonding them together into a cohesive rock.

Weathering can reshape existing sandstone formations, creating dramatic landforms. The interplay of these processes, constantly transforming, gives rise to the multifaceted and awe-inspiring sandstone formations we admire today.
